The gap
Your device has several ways to connect. Most software still uses them one at a time.
Failover happens too late
A call, stream, or remote session drops before the backup link takes over.
Conditions are not binary
A connection becomes slow and lossy long before it disappears.
Mobile networks are hard to reach
CGNAT and changing carrier addresses make direct connectivity unreliable.

Is Nexus Atlas a conventional privacy VPN?+
Its primary purpose is resilient connectivity and connection bonding, not changing your apparent location—although a full-tunnel exit through a hosted Nexus Atlas gateway, or through an exit node you operate yourself, does exactly that. (Relays are different: they only forward encrypted frames between your own nodes and provide no internet exit.)
Can I use my own server?+
Yes. Self-hosted Atlas endpoints are a first-class deployment option.
Does Android combine two SIM cards?+
Consumer Android devices generally cannot keep two cellular data sessions active simultaneously. Atlas can combine Wi-Fi and cellular, or use another phone or router as an additional link.
Can it run beside another Android VPN?+
Android allows one active VPN per user profile, so Atlas cannot normally run beside another VPN in the same profile.
What is Nexus Atlas.NET?+
It is the optional traversal and relay suite that helps Atlas endpoints connect through CGNAT and changing carrier networks.
Do my applications need to support Nexus Atlas?+
No. Applications use a normal network interface while Atlas manages the available connections underneath.
